## 如何实现“profiling MySQL分析”
### 流程图
```mermaid
flowchart TD
A(开始)
B(连接数据库)
C(开启profiling)
D(执行SQL查询)
E(关闭profiling)
F(查看分析结果)
G(结束)
A --> B
B --> C
C -->
原创
2024-04-30 05:06:30
29阅读
Profinet 技术简介 PLC攻城狮 《想了解Profinet,这一篇就够了》profinet的历史 Profinet是一种工业总线标准,设计用于在工业系统中收集并传输数据,并且可以实现实时数据的发送和接受(1ms或者更短)。Profinet标准化组织隶属于 Profibus&Profinet intermational(PI),位于德国的Karlsruhe。profinet的概述 P
参l提供可以用来分析当前会话中语句执行的资源消耗情况,可以用于Sql调优的测量。示例1、先查看是否开启了此功能,默认情况下,参数处于关闭状态,为OFF状态show variables like 'profiling%';2、开启Profiling:setprofiling=1;3、展示最近的SQL执行情况:s...
原创
2022-11-21 13:20:12
141阅读
MySQL中提供了内置的性能分析工具profiling, 今天就一起看下这个工具怎么使用.首先确认profiling工具状态查看profiling相关变量: 开关及存储记录数show VARIABLES like 'profil%'-------------------------------profiling ONprofiling_history_size 15为了方便
原创
2021-02-26 17:18:13
692阅读
转自:://.cppblog./sunicdavy/archive/2015/04/11/210308.html 本文介绍游戏服务器的性能分析, web服务器性能分析不在本文分析范畴之内 Golang编写的服务器可以方便的通过内建性能分析, 输出图表仔细查找原因, 非常的方便,
转载
2017-07-07 16:38:00
255阅读
2评论
目录文章目录目录ProfilingruntimeMemStatGCpproftraceDEBUGProfilingGolang 提供了友好的工程化支持,其中之一就是 Profiling(分析)工具。例如:Golang 自带的 runtime 包,就可以轻松获取程序运行期间的各种内存或 CPU 的使用状态信息。runtimeMemStat查看内存使用情况:package mainimport ( "fmt" "runtime")func main() { var m runtim
原创
2022-03-22 10:08:23
439阅读
目录文章目录目录ProfilingruntimeMemStatGCpproftraceDEBUGProfilingGolang 提供了友好的工程化支持,其中之一就是 Profiling(分析)工具。例如:Golang 自带的 runtime 包,就可以轻松获取程序运行期间的各种内存或 CPU 的使用状态信息。runtimeMemStat查看内存使用情况:package mainimport ( "fmt" "runtime")func main() { var m runtim
原创
2021-07-14 11:51:15
409阅读
在MySQL数据库中,可以通过配置profiling参数来启用SQL剖析。该参数可以在全局和session级别来设置。对于全局级别则作用于整个MySQL实例,而session级别紧影响当前session。该参数开启后,后续执行的SQL语句都将记录其资源开销,诸如IO,上下文切换,CPU,Memory等等。
转载
2019-10-24 16:55:00
843阅读
1评论
# Profiling分析Go语言性能
随着微服务架构的普及,Go语言(Golang)由于其高效性和简洁性越来越受到开发者的青睐。然而,如何优化Go程序的性能是每位开发者需要面对的挑战。Profiling是一种分析程序性能的技术,能够帮助我们找出性能瓶颈并进行优化。本文将探讨Go语言中的Profiling分析,并提供代码示例以说明其具体用法。
## 什么是Profiling
Profilin
如果要进行SQL的调优优化和排查,第一步是先让故障重现,但是这个并不是这一分钟有问题,下一秒就OK。一般的企业一般是DBA数据库工程师从监控里找到问题。DBA会告诉我们让我们来排查问题,那么可能很多种原因,也许是程序内存泄漏、也许是网络、也许是死锁、也许是SQL写的烂。假设是SQL问题我们需要把SQ
原创
2021-05-27 13:43:50
586阅读
Benchmark:系统的瓶颈
测量应用现有的性能
校验系统可扩展性:通过增加压力测试
估算业务增长后,对硬件 资源 网络的需求
测试系统对环境变化的容忍度:短暂的并行峰值、服务器的配置改变
不同硬件
原创
2011-11-18 16:39:35
842阅读
Linux profiling是一个非常重要的概念,它可以帮助开发人员更好地了解程序在Linux系统上的性能表现。通过对程序进行profiling,开发人员可以找出程序中的性能瓶颈,进而对程序进行优化,提高程序的运行效率。
在Linux系统中,有许多工具可以用来进行profiling,比如gprof、perf、valgrind等。这些工具可以帮助开发人员收集程序运行时的性能数据,比如函数调用时间
原创
2024-05-08 10:54:07
163阅读
一值,缺失值 分位数统计信息,例如最小值,Q1,中位数,Q3...
原创
2023-03-03 06:54:02
241阅读
Data Profiling Task 是用于收集数据的Metadata的Task,在使用ETL处理数据之前,应该首先检查数据质量,对数据进行分析,这将对Table Schema的设计结构和生成ETL的方式产生不可估量的影响。 Data Profiling Task 输出XML格式的数据文件,并能通
转载
2016-05-20 11:28:00
95阅读
2评论
转自:https://zeebe.io/blog/2019/12/zeebe-performance-profiling/ by Josh Wulf and Klaus Nji on Dec 22 2019 in BenchmarksPerformance. We frequently get qu
转载
2021-07-19 09:56:58
419阅读
MongoDB Database ProfilingMongoDB Profiler是一个捕获数据库执行活动的系统,它可以帮助识别慢查询和操作。 Profiling级别可用的捕获级别意义如下:级别 设置0 禁用1 启用,只记录慢操作2 启用,记录所有操作 查看Profiling级别> db.getProfilingLevel() 启用Profiler&
原创
精选
2015-05-25 16:24:43
2854阅读
Data Profiling Task 是用于收集数据的Metadata的Task,在使用ETL处理数据之前,应该首先检查数据质量,对数据进行分析,这将对Table Schema的设计结构和生成ETL的方式产生不可估量的影响。Data Profiling Task 输出XML格式的数据文件,并能通过Open Profile Viewer 查看输出结果
转载
2017-04-25 10:11:14
480阅读
MySQL5.0版本之后开放了profiling功能,通过此功能可以查询某个SQL的详细执行计划。1、开启profilingmysql> show variables like '%profil%';+------------------------+-------+| Variable_name | Value |+------------------------+-
原创
2021-04-10 08:54:39
410阅读
Linux profiling工具是开发人员在进行性能优化和调试时的利器。在Linux操作系统中,有多种优秀的profiling工具可供选择,如gprof、perf、valgrind等。这些工具可以帮助开发人员找出代码中的性能瓶颈,从而进一步优化程序的性能和效率。
其中,gprof是一个老牌的profiling工具,它能够生成程序的调用图和调用关系,帮助开发人员找到程序中耗时较长的函数或代码段,
原创
2024-05-15 11:22:12
137阅读
Universal Profiling 是Es提供的一种分析工具,可以根据官方描述,它基本上对业务是零侵入,运行成本极低的一个工具。
原创
2023-12-01 12:29:55
782阅读